If you're selling a flat or apartment in Aberdeen right now, you already know the market is competitive. It’s a buyer’s market and stock is high so properties that might have moved quickly a few years ago are taking longer to sell. In this environment, the difference between a swift sale and a slow one often comes down to something sellers underestimate – how the property looks. Not just in person, from the very first photo.
A buyer scrolling through listings on the ASPC, Zoopla and Rightmove will make a decision about whether to click through in seconds. If the photos don’t create an immediate sense of somewhere they could picture themselves, they’ll scroll on.

What staging actually does
There’s a common misconception that home staging is about making a property look like a showroom, but done well, it’s much more than that.
Professional staging is about removing the friction between a buyer and a decision. It addresses the things that make a buyer hesitate – the layout that doesn’t flow, the room with no purpose and the impression that a property “needs work” – and replaces them with clarity, warmth and a confidence that this is where they could move straight into.
For ex-rental properties in particular, this matters enormously. A property that’s been tenanted for several years is often very obvious to a fresh pair of eyes. Buyers factor in the work they think a property needs and negotiate accordingly. The right staging changes that perception before they even walk through the door.
